The total elevation difference for this wilderness trail is 3,309 feet which is higher than average. This wilderness trail has two trailheads which means you have the option of backpacking it one way if you have someone to pick you up at the other end. You should count on this trek taking about 6.5 hours, but you never know stuff could go wrong and you could get stuck so be prepared for that. Being 7.4 miles long it's a mid length hike. Chorro Grande Trail goes through some very different elevations which of course means you need to be prepared for different conditions on different parts of the wilderness trail. This region does get very dry sometimes, so do check for current fire restrictions before you go if you plan to bring a stove or make a camp fire. This is a long backpacking and hiking trail, so make sure you bring plenty of supplies.
